The California Grape Crush Report is only filed once a year—but the information needed to complete it correctly is generated throughout harvest.
By the time the filing deadline arrives, winery employees may be sorting through weigh tags, grower information, grape purchases, custom-crush activity and production records while also trying to determine which version of the report their business is required to use.
